Sheldon, Iowa — A Sheldon woman faces Identity Theft and Forgery charges, following her arrest Wednesday, July 27th.
The Sioux County Sheriff’s Office says the charges against 30-year old Nohemi Garcia-De La Cruz are the result of the investigation into a complaint by a Mississippi resident that their identity was illegally being used in Sioux County.
Deputies say their investigation discovered that Garcia-De La Cruz was illegally using the victim’s identity to gain employment at Natural Beauty Growers of Boyden.
According to authorities, Garcia-De La Cruz was arrested for Identity Theft and two counts of Forgery. Each charge is a Class D Felony.
